Vendresse (French pronunciation: [vɑ̃dʁɛs]) is a commune in the Ardennes department and Grand Est region of north-eastern France.

Population
| Year | Pop. | ±% p.a. |
|---|---|---|
| 1968 | 515 | — |
| 1975 | 469 | −1.33% |
| 1982 | 406 | −2.04% |
| 1990 | 402 | −0.12% |
| 1999 | 400 | −0.06% |
| 2009 | 486 | +1.97% |
| 2014 | 521 | +1.40% |
| 2020 | 477 | −1.46% |
| Source: INSEE[3] | ||
The inhabitants of Vendresse are known as Vendressois in French.
